Output e5383356614e880585f789a0020d7947ef846fba53923dfcfdbf1a1d3400e0bc:1

value
2243276
script pubkey
OP_HASH160 OP_PUSHBYTES_20 182ae1a74ac5904a9a03005f575fe0c55dc48ecd OP_EQUAL
address
33toWby3X4j9zeP8fBX2rjRixhzYPbV9pV
transaction
e5383356614e880585f789a0020d7947ef846fba53923dfcfdbf1a1d3400e0bc
spent
true